A conversation that is still working on the machine no longer looks finished. When Claude Code starts a long command or an agent in the background and hands you back the prompt, the chat used to go quiet — no spinner, no badge, nothing to say the test it kicked off was still running and that it would come back with the results. Now the server reports the work as long as it runs, and every surface wears it: the chat sits in LIVE NOW with a BACKGROUND pill and a breathing timer badge, the row's second line quotes the task in the agent's own words, the chat's own status reads the count, the orb at the top of Home breathes with one satellite for it, and a screen reader hears that the agent continues on its own when the work ends. The prompt stays open the whole time, because Claude accepts your next message while it waits. Requires the latest claude-bridge on the server; nothing changes for opencode or Oh My Pi, which have no background tasks to report.
